Hot Shooting Georgia Downs UTC, 86-55

  • Tuesday, December 2, 2014
  • B.B. Branton

Georgia guard Kenny Gaines hit the game’s first 3-pointer in the first 30 seconds and it proved to be a preview of things to come.

The Dawgs from Athens (4-3) kept hitting 3s (7 of 11, 63.6%) and also 2s (31-49, 63.3%) on the way to an 86-55 win against host Chattanooga at McKenzie Arena Tuesday night in a men’s college basketball game.

Gaines had a season-high 25 points (9-11 from the field) while teammate Marcus Thornton contributed with a career-best 24 points, plus six boards and Nemanja Djurisic had 10 points and a game-best eight boards.

“This was a really good win for us as our guys were geared up for the game, shot the ball well and our defense was good,” said Georgia coach Mark Fox who has 89 wins in six seasons in Athens.

“We really respected UTC and played hard and we needed to come in here get a win because we needed some confidence,” stated Fox as the Dawgs were coming off losing two games in the NIT Season Tip Off in New York City last week.

The Mocs were led by Casey Jones with 19 points and five rebounds, followed by Justin Tuoyo with eight points, four boards, three blocks and two assists.

“I felt good at half trailing by only seven (39-32), but we didn’t make open shots in the second half (6-28, 21.4%) and they hit theirs (16-24, 66.7%),” said UTC coach Will Wade.

First Half: Georgia 39-32 ...

Georgia took early lead at 5-0 as Kenny Gains drained a 3 and then a 2-pointer .. but UTC's Casey Jones scored six of the Mocs first 10 points as it was tied 10-10 at 16:04 ona 3-pointer by Greg Pryor ... UGa led by as many as 11 at 23-12 at 10:48 .. Mocs cut it to five at 34-29 at 3:30 on a 3-point play by Justin Tuoyo.

Second Half: Georgia was up 15 at 52-37 at 14:01 on a 3-pointer by Juwan Parker ... Black and Red went up 20 at 57-37 at 12:36 on layup by Nemanja Djurisic ... Mocs were down 16 (63-47) on free throws by Casey Jones ... he scored seven points in 2:30 ... UTC never got closer than 16.

Good Things for UTC: “We shared the ball, found the right guy and had the open looks, but just didn’t make the shots,” Wade stated.  “In the first half, I felt good where we were (down 7), the pace was good, but didn’t sustain it.”

Notes: Hot Shooting – last time Georgia shot 60% or better was 60% last February in a 91-78 win against LSU …

UTC Game Plan: “We didn’t want them to pound the ball inside and we hoped they would shoot their season average (44.1%), but they didn’t,” coach Wade said. “It’s a game of give and take and they hit their shots.”

Record vs. UGa:  Georgia leads 28-5 ... last UTC win was 73-70 in the NCAA tournament in 1997 ... last win in McKenzie was an NIT victory in 1984 (74-69 (OT)

Good Crowd: 3,784 ... largest home crowd of the season

200 Assists: UTC's Ronrico White had four assists tonight for 203 for a career
